The Purchasing Agent I is responsible for executing all aspects of purchasing to efficiently and cost-effectively support organizational operations. The ideal candidate will have prior experience generating all purchase orders for raw materials, equipment, tools, parts and supplies. This individual will also be required to plan and schedule deliveries to optimize inventories in support of production schedules and business demands.
Key Responsibilities- Sources equipment, goods, fabrication and services along with vendor identification and management
- Reviews purchase requisitions and confer with suppliers to obtain product information such as price, availability and delivery schedule.
- Receives price quotes from vendors, compare quotes against requirements and the budget, and purchase orders.
- Negotiates purchase orders and closes deals with optimal terms.
- Verifies receipt of items by comparing items received to items ordered. Resolves any shipment errors with suppliers.
- Support the development and implementation of new purchasing strategies to deliver ongoing cost reductions and process simplification.
- Enters purchase orders for OE, AM, and stock for multiple brands. Includes fabrication PO’s along with buyout items.
- Assists in input and updating min/max data on stock/raw material.
- Maintains positive and cooperative communications with all stakeholders.
- Updates pricing in database on commodities (under the direction of management).
- Monitors vendor schedules to maximize on-time deliveries to ensure that required schedules are being met.
- Ensure all procured items are delivered as per Purchase Order due dates, will proactive follow up.
